"I'm not going."
"I know you don't want to…"
"I'm not going."
Traci stopped, exasperated, and looked at her son. "Why not?"
"Because."
"Leo, because is not a good answer. You are going to spend the weekend with Daddy."
"He just spends all that time with that lady. The one you said was a friend of his."
"He doesn't spend any time with you?" That didn't sound like Dex.
"He does, but she doesn't like me and I know she doesn't like me."
Traci raised an eyebrow. This was a new one. She would have to talk to Dex about Leo's feelings, not that Dex would actually listen to her. "He is still your father and you are going to him for the weekend."
"Why? He doesn't like me. Why can't Jerry be my Daddy?"
Before Traci could formulate an answer, the current topic of their discussion walked in. "Leo, you ready to go?"
Leo looked at his mother. "You see? Jerry cares."
Jerry looked at Traci and raised a questioning eyebrow. She gave a subtle jerk with her head. "I see you are not ready. Five minutes, okay little man?" he ruffled Leo's hair and slipped out of the room. He had caught Traci's signal that she needed to be alone with her son.
Traci sighed when Jerry left the room. Dex told her he had broken up to try with her. In truth, the yoga teacher had broken up with Dex and Dex used Traci as a pawn to get his girl back. Dex also did not like it that Leo kept asking for Jerry.
"Leo, I will talk to Daddy. We will see if something can be worked out."
"But Mommy, why can't Jerry be my Daddy?"
Traci groaned. "Leo, do Mommy a big favor and don't mention that to your Daddy. I am going to take care of it."
"Promise?"
"I promise."
Leo gave her a big hug and then ran out of the room screaming "Jerry, I'm ready!"
Later that evening, Traci and Jerry sat on his deck, snuggling together under a blanket. As much as he loved Traci's little boy, he enjoyed having Traci to himself. "So," he murmured in her ear "wanna tell me what happened before while you were packing? Leo normally rushes you."
Traci pulled away to look at him. "He hates Dex right now."
Jerry was startled. Of all the answers, that was not what he expected. "Since when? Why? Two weeks ago he was so excited to see him."
"The girl Dex is dating, again. The one he used me as a tool towards getting her back. She doesn't like Leo and Leo knows it. Leo thinks Dex doesn't like him." Tears began pooling in her eyes.
Jerry pulled her close. "Sh, Trace, it's just a stage. He will grow out of it."
"There's more" she said into his chest.
Jerry rubbed her back and patiently waited for her to compose herself.
"He wanted to know why Dex is his father. He wants you to be his Daddy."
Jerry gasped. "What did you tell him?"
Traci buried her head deeper into his chest. "I told him I would work it out."
Jerry pushed away from her and cupped her head in his hands. "Are you saying what I think I am saying?"
Traci nodded against his hands. "If Dex doesn't want him, he can just leave. I can manage Leo alone and I know you'll be there to help me."
Jerry kissed her sweetly. "Always."
